**Building Access: Roof-Terrace Door (Marden Point, Level 11)**

The roof-terrace door at Marden Point has a known jamming issue, particularly in damp weather when the frame swells. Night shift staff should not force it; a firm pull on the handle while lifting slightly usually releases the latch. If it remains stuck, use the plant-room route via the east stairwell instead. Report each jam in the shift log so Facilities can track frequency. The east stairwell door is kept locked overnight, so you'll need the override code.

staff pass of kawip-hawef = bdg-QLP-2

Handover: Brivano billing worker, blue-green.

Green stack is warmed and passing synthetic charges. Cutover window approved by Odessa on the Fenwick side. Drain blue only after the ledger queue hits zero — don't force it. Rollback is a single alias flip; no DB migrations this cycle. Keep both stacks running 24h post-switch. Current green configuration is as follows.

config for yajep-tafof:
[rusath]
team = julmir
access_code = ac_fe37fd
host = rusath.novactech.test
port = 8000
owner = pelmir.weneth
peer = oliwyn.olvarqdyn.internal

Subject: Partner SFTP drop — new owner

Hi,

As you review the pending changes to the Harborline ingest scripts, note that ownership of the partner SFTP drop is changing at the end of the month. This includes key rotation, the nightly pull job, and the quarantine folder for malformed files. Review comments on the retry logic should still go through the normal PR flow, but questions about drop-folder conventions or partner onboarding now go to the new owner. The incoming owner is listed below.

signatory, tagaf-bahaf: Praael Fenmir Rusok